I have had the Forever Fern Bundle for just over a week now and wanted to use it for this challenge. The distinctive stamps in this set are stunning but I have decided to limit my stamping as the leaf flourishes in the Forever Flourishing Die bundles are equally as stunning.



  1. Start with a Crumb Cake card base measuring 21cm x 10.5cm scored and folded in half. 
  2. Cut a piece of Whisper White card stock to measure 10.cm x 14.2cm for your matt layer.
  3. Then cut another piece of Whisper White to measure 14.2cm x 4.5cm. Run this piece through your die cutting machine using the Greenery Embossing Folder.
  4. Adhere a 14.2cm piece of Purple Posy Scalloped Ribbon trim along one side of the embossed piece with Tear & Tape.
  5. Glue this to the Whisper White matt layer and then to the card base.
  6. Stamp the bud image in Rococo Rose ink and the Sentiment in Crumb Cake  on Whisper White card stock. 
  7. Die cut the Rococo Rose bud with the coordinating die.
  8. Die cut the sentiment with a layering circle die. Then cut the next size up scalloped circle in Whisper White. Use dimensionals to pop the sentiment layer up on the scalloped circle piece.
  9. Die cut the leaf images in Soft Sea Foam card stock.
  10. Die cut the Purple Posy card stock using what I think is more bud images strung together.  Cut this piece into three separate pieces.
  11. Using glue dots adhere the leaves and flora to the left hand side of the card. 
  12. Using dimensionals adhere the sentiment layer to the top of the leaves and flora layer.
